About Rexo2

Summary

Predicted to enable 3'-5'-exoribonuclease activity. Predicted to be involved in RNA phosphodiester bond hydrolysis, exonucleolytic. Predicted to act upstream of or within nucleobase-containing compound metabolic process. Predicted to be located in focal adhesion and nucleolus. Predicted to be active in mitochondrion. Orthologous to human REXO2 (RNA exonuclease 2).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
